April 2019 College Accomplishments • Students in the 10th, 11th or 12th grade from 13 of the 15 public high schools can split time between their high school and any EFSC campus. • The program can be completed with little to no cost to the student. The high schools also provide all required textbooks. • To enter, students need an unweighted high school GPA of at least 3.0, and college-ready reading and writing scores. A college ready mathematics score is required by the time they reach 12th grade. • The program attracts a diverse student population and includes students who are low income, minority, and students with disabilities. • Dual enrollment increased 5 percent from 2014-19 to 3,779 students. • During the same time, the proportion of those in the Collegiate High program has increased from 34.1 percent to 42.9 percent. • The proportion of minority students participating has increased from 33.2 percent to 37.7 percent. • Completion rates remained high, increasing to 68.4 percent for the group that completed high school in 2018-19. • The graduation rate for minority students in the program increased to 74.6 percent in 2018-19. Best Online Degrees EFSC placed two of its online degrees – one Associate in Science and one Bachelor - in the top national ranks, according to online education surveys. (Student Enrollment, Diversity Initiatives, Financial Management) 8 2019 College Accomplishments • The two degrees are an Associate in Science Degree in Business Management and a Bachelor Degree in Information Technology. • The Associate Degree was named among the Top 20 online two- year business degrees by Business Management Degree.net. • The findings were based on information from the National Center for Education Statistics. • Key areas reviewed included how coursework seeks to develop students’ interpersonal and communication skills, project planning techniques, and business ethics. • The report stated “all these skills are essential for landing entry- level business jobs and pursuing a Bachelor’s Degree in the same discipline.” • The Bachelor Degree was named among the Top 25 most affordable by TheBestSchools.Org. • The findings were based on information from the National Center for Education Statistics. • They considered the quality of the program, types of online information technology classes offered, faculty, rankings, awards and reputation.
